Pitlimal - Tamia, Chhindwara
Pitlimal is a village situated in the Tamia tehsil of Chhindwara district, Madhya Pradesh. It is located approximately 35 km from the tehsil headquarters in Tamia and around 86 km from the district headquarters in Chhindwara. Chopna serves as the Gram Panchayat for Pitlimal village.
As per Census 2011, the village code of Pitlimal is 493843. The village covers a total geographical area of 286.61 hectares and falls under the 480559 pincode. Dongar Parasia is the nearest town, located about 71 km away.
Pitlimal village is governed under the Panchayati Raj system, with a Sarpanch serving as the elected head. For political representation, the village falls under the Amarwara Vidhan Sabha (Assembly) constituency and the Chhindwara Lok Sabha (Parliamentary) constituency.
Population of Pitlimal
According to the 2011 Census, Pitlimal village had a total population of 506 people, including 254 males and 252 females, living in 105 households. The sex ratio was 992 females per 1,000 males. The overall literacy rate was 63.30%, with male literacy at 75.57% and female literacy at 50.70%. The Scheduled Tribe (ST) population was 463.

Transport and Connectivity of Pitlimal
Pitlimal is connected by an all-weather road, and public transport is mainly available through bus services.
| Connectivity | Status | Nearest Availability |
|---|---|---|
| Public Bus Service | No | Available within >10 km |
| Private Bus Service | No | Available within >10 km |
| Railway Station | No | - |
In addition to basic transport facilities, distances and travel times help define overall connectivity. The road distance from Dongar Parasia to Pitlimal is about 71 km, with a usual travel time of around ~2 hours. Similarly, the road distance from Chhindwara to Pitlimal is about 86 km, with the usual travel time around ~2.5 hours. Actual travel time may vary depending on road conditions and mode of transport.
